King Arthur and his knights go on a quest from god to find the Holy Grail, while having to deal with Frenchmen, virgins, killer rabbits and other zany dangers.


In the late 60's and early 70's there was a British comedy show called Monty Python's Flying Circus. Is was a typical sketch format show, much like Saturday Night Live. They were a smash in Europe, but over in America not many knew about it. And most of us were introduced to the show by seeing this movie and learning about it later on. I was one of those folks.

When I first saw this movie I didn't really understand it at first, maybe because I was younger and had a small attention span. The only thing I found to be funny was the black knight scene. But years later when I re-watched it, I was literally rolling on the floor laughing.

The black knight scene was just as funny as ever, as was the killer rabbit, the whole obsesiveness about swallows, coconuts and shrubberies. Even the fact that right from the opening credits it tries to be serious, but there’s all these ridiculous subtitles and stuff about mooses, then the scene revealing the coconuts instead of horses is just clever. I can actually make the noise with my hands instead of using coconuts. And fourth wall humor is always funny. I could talk about this film for hours it's that great.

It's got great characters and wonderfully funny scenes and is always worth watching at least many times over.

Final Rating: 9/10

When it comes to the Monty Python films, Americans tend to enjoy Holy Grail the most. Britain's enjoy Life of Brian more... I can honestly say as an American this is indeed true.

Quest for the Holy Grail is one of the funniest movies ever made. But I find that when it comes to anything Python or British for that matter, it is an acquired taste. British humor is very dry, and quite a few of the jokes go well over the heads of American viewers. Even me the first time I've seen it. But the more I watch British television, the more their comedic style rubbed off on me, and in many cases I'll take the dry comedy from Jolly old England over the crap that has passed off as comedy here in the states in recent years.

So if you like killer bunnies, Knights of Ni, bizarre witch hunts and intellectual discussions about Swallows, then Quest for the Holy Grail is the perfect film for you.
